In the realm of EB-5 financial investments, the bulk of financial investments are structured to satisfy the requirements of a Targeted Work Location (TEA). By finding the investment in a TEA, investors come to be eligible for the lower investment threshold, which currently stands at $800,000. Spending in a TEA not just permits capitalists to make a reduced resources financial investment but likewise offers a new class of visas that have no waiting line, and investments into a rural area qualify for concern handling.


These non-TEA projects may provide different financial investment possibilities and job types, providing to financiers with varying preferences and purposes. Ultimately, the decision to invest in a TEA or non-TEA task depends on a person's economic capacities, financial investment goals, threat tolerance, and placement with their individual preferences.

Financiers commonly ask about the possible Return on Investment (ROI) they can anticipate from their EB-5 investment. It's crucial to keep in mind that EB-5 offerings usually do not provide the same ROI as basic financial investments as a result of details factors to consider special to the EB-5 program.


Lately, these investments have actually given ROIs ranging from 0.25% to 8% per year. However, it's important to comprehend that these returns specify to investments offered and differ depending upon the private project's attributes. EB-5 investments normally have actually extra expenses connected with structuring the investment within the program's demands. There is a level of unpredictability concerning when the invested resources will be readily available to the task.

The timing of when investors can anticipate to get their EB-5 funds back is reliant on a number of aspects. It is essential for financiers to have a clear understanding click here of the nature of their financial investment and the terms laid out in the operating agreement. It's essential to acknowledge that financiers are making an equity investment in the New Commercial Business (NCE), which after that gives a car loan to the Task Creating Entity (JCE).




To analyze the timing of the funding repayment by the JCE, financiers ought to extensively examine the finance terms. This consists of understanding when the finance begins, the timeline for repayment, and any kind of arrangements for possible extensions. By having a clear understanding of the car loan terms, financiers can approximate when they might get their initial investment back from the JCE.Furthermore, as soon as the funds are gone back to the NCE, there may be possibilities for reinvestment.


This agreement offers information on when and just how the NCE will certainly be dissolved, permitting capitalists to have an idea of when they could expect to obtain their funding back. Financiers must thoroughly review the operating arrangement and consult with legal and financial professionals to ensure a detailed understanding of the investment framework, timing, and potential returns.

In the context of EB-5 financial investments, it is essential to highlight that there can be no warranty or guarantee of when a capitalist will certainly receive repayment of their funds. If such an assurance exists, it can increase worries and potentially lead to the denial of the financier's EB-5 application by USCIS.
